Finland - Fertilizer Consumption

Since 2014, Finland Fertilizer Consumption fell by 1% year on year. With 88.09 Kilograms Per Hectare of Arable Land in 2019, the country was number 90 among other countries in Fertilizer Consumption. Finland is overtaken by Estonia, which was number 89 at 88.55 Kilograms Per Hectare of Arable Land and is followed by Australia with 87.46 Kilograms Per Hectare of Arable Land. Malaysia ranked the highest with 2,158.64 Kilograms Per Hectare of Arable Land in 2019, that is an increase of 2.5% compared to 2018. New Zealand, Ireland and Bahrain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ic recorded the best 5 years average growth at +98.7% per year, while Singapore rec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
